Taxi Driver Docked Over Breach Of Trust

A 35-year-old man,  Suleiman Abubakar, who alleged bought a car on hire purchase but reneged on repayment schedule, was yesterday brought before a Wuse Zone 2 Magistrates’ Court,  Abuja.
The accused, who is a taxi driver in Abuja, is facing a two-count charge of criminal breach of trust and cheating.
Abubakar, however, pleaded not guilty to the charge.
But Police Prosecutor Adeyemi Oyeyemi insisted that the Abubakar committed the offences sometime in April 2013.
Oyeyemi said the complainant, Mr Amos Williams of Army Headquarters, Wuse Zone 3, Abuja, bought a Golf 3 saloon car in 2013 and gave it to Abubakar on hire purchase.
The accused bought the car on hire purchase at a cost of N200,000, but he failed to remit money to the complainant after receiving the car, he told the court.
The offences contravened Sections  312 and 322 of the Penal Code.
Ruling on the bail application of the accused, Magistrate Jim Zimizu admitted him to a bail of N100, 000 with one surety in like sum.
Further hearing has been adjourned until May 17.
